Analysis of hypertrophied ligamentum flavum (HLF) samples from patients with LSCS can be ... WebSpondylosis is the term used to describe degeneration and arthritis of the facet joints. Degeneration of the spine is a normal aging process, and in most cases spinal arthritis does not cause significant symptoms.
